Anthropic interpretability researcher tells Tim O'Reilly: an LLM's world model is readable
mlpowered · x · 2026-09-17
Tim O'Reilly interviewed Emmanuel Ameisen, a researcher on Anthropic's AI interpretability team, going deep on what happens inside an LLM while it processes text. Core claims: prediction demands a world model; that world model is readable; and it is at work in every token. Researchers study activation patterns between layers to see which patterns correspond to particular ideas, and can even intervene by replacing activations with different values to observe how behavior changes. O'Reilly notes the most provocative angle is what studying LLMs might teach us about being human.
